Gathering Your Materials

Now that you’re excited about the possibilities, let’s explore what you’ll need for this crafting adventure. If you’re anything like me, witnessing a range of colorful materials come together is half the fun.

  • Clean Metal Bottle Caps: These are the canvas for your creative expression. Each cap holds the potential for a tiny masterpiece.
  • Acrylic Craft Paint: Choose your favorite colors—be it the soothing hues of blue and green or the vibrant cheeriness of red and yellow.
  • Fine Paintbrushes and Dotting Tools: The fine brushes will help you navigate the details while dotting tools offer precision for your flower designs.
  • Small Round Disc Magnets: These will turn your painted caps into lovely magnets, perfect for sticking on fridges or magnetic boards.
  • Hot Glue Gun and Glue Sticks: A reliable partner in ensuring your creations stick around for longer.
  • Parchment Paper or a Protective Craft Surface: Protect your workspace while you unleash your creativity.

Crafting Your Bottle Cap Flower Magnets

Ready to dive in? Let’s walk through the steps to bring these magnetic flowers to life with a delightful ease that allows you to lose yourself in creativity.

  1. Clean the Bottle Caps: Start by washing and drying each metal bottle cap thoroughly to remove any leftover residue from their previous life. This sets the stage for beautiful paint adherence.

  2. Base Color Coating: Choose a solid, vibrant base color for each cap. Imagine the joy as the colors begin to transform the mundane into the extraordinary. Using a fine paintbrush, apply a thin layer of paint and allow it to dry completely. If you’re feeling adventurous, double-dip with a second coat for smoother coverage.

  3. Flower Design Magic: Now comes the fun part! Use dotting tools or the end of a paintbrush handle to add petals and flower centers in contrasting colors within each cap. Think of your favorite flowers—the delicate swirls of daisies, the bold strokes of sunflowers, or the soft petals of tulips. Let your imagination run wild!

  4. Drying Time: Let your painted caps dry completely. This is an excellent time to sip your favorite beverage or put some music on while you await the transformation.

  5. Attaching Magnets: Using your hot glue gun, attach a small round magnet to the inside back of each bottle cap. Press it gently to ensure it sticks. Watch as your creations come together, eager to find a home on your refrigerator or locker.

  6. Final Touch: Once the glue has set, your flower magnets are ready for their unveiling!

Tips to Elevate Your Craft

As you embark on this crafting journey, here are several tips to keep in mind:

  • Thin Coats Are Key: Smooth coverage is crucial. Applying two thin coats of paint is often more effective than a single thick one, reducing drips and ensuring a polished look.

  • Experiment with Dot Sizes: Don’t be afraid to mix up the sizes of your dots for added personality in your flower designs. Tiny dots can create accents, while larger ones may serve as stunning flower centers.

  • Seal for Longevity: If you desire added durability, a clear craft sealer can preserve your beautiful artwork, protecting colors from fading or chipping over time.

Avoiding Common Mistakes

As with any creative endeavor, sometimes it’s easy to encounter a stumble. Here are a few common pitfalls to avoid:

  • Skipping the Cleaning Step: Leaving residue on the caps can compromise paint adhesion. Ensure they’re clean before you begin.

  • Rushing the Drying Process: Patience is a virtue! Rushing to glue your magnets while the paint is still wet can lead to smudged designs. Allow ample time for each layer to dry.

Frequently Asked Questions

  1. Can I use plastic bottle caps?

    • While plastic bottle caps can be painted, they may not hold up as well as metal caps when magnets are applied.
  2. What can I do if I don’t have a dotting tool?

    • The end of a paintbrush handle can work just as well! Alternatively, you can employ cotton swabs for smaller details.
  3. How do I clean my brush between colors?

    • A quick rinse in water can keep your brush clean between colors, ensuring you maintain vibrant designs.
